I have a 1990 Sunny GTS (Japs), it has 4 disc brakes. Whenever i pull up the emergency brake only one side holds(left). You'll have to pull it all the way up for the other to hold. Which is not much help when parked on a grad. Could someone tell me how to correct this.
I was told that the brakes are self-adjust, is that true and if so what else could be the problem.

Yes. I think it is the one thats not holdingg (right). I did check the cable and I dont find anything wrong with it (I found out that my stablizer link gone bad, good thing i got under there). Now the ultimate question ... where is or what is the balance bar?
underneath the car, right below the ebrake, there's a balance bar that splits 1 line into 2 lines. You will have to remove 1 of the heat shields to get to it.
